The R.MS. Empress of Canada (Canadian Pacifc. Steamships, Limited) arrived at Vancouver on the 7th November Wednesday) at noon, leaves Vancouver on the 17th November (Saturday) at am.. is due at Hong Kong on the 7th December (Friday) at am, and leaves Hong Kong for Manila on the same day at p..

CHINESE VESSEL IN DISTRESS

Moppo, Nov. 2. Grave fears are entertained here for the fate of a Chinese freigh- ter Tang Fu, whose S. O. signals were intercepted by a local station this morning.
